Analysis

Gambia recorded 14.21 for share edu spending gdp vs share edu total spending in 2025.

The figure is down 5.9% on the previous year and up 28.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share edu spending gdp vs share edu total spending in Gambia peaked at 18.88 in 2008 and was at its lowest, 5.03, in 2004.

Gambia ranks 70th of 190 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 26 years of available data.
